Solution for 1=4(x-1)+4-3x equation:


Simplifying
1 = 4(x + -1) + 4 + -3x

Reorder the terms:
1 = 4(-1 + x) + 4 + -3x
1 = (-1 * 4 + x * 4) + 4 + -3x
1 = (-4 + 4x) + 4 + -3x

Reorder the terms:
1 = -4 + 4 + 4x + -3x

Combine like terms: -4 + 4 = 0
1 = 0 + 4x + -3x
1 = 4x + -3x

Combine like terms: 4x + -3x = 1x
1 = 1x

Solving
1 = 1x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1x' to each side of the equation.
1 + -1x = 1x + -1x

Combine like terms: 1x + -1x = 0
1 + -1x = 0

Add '-1' to each side of the equation.
1 + -1 + -1x = 0 + -1

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0
0 + -1x = 0 + -1
-1x = 0 + -1

Combine like terms: 0 + -1 = -1
-1x = -1

Divide each side by '-1'.
x = 1

Simplifying
x = 1
